
Vitamin D3 and vitamin K2 are two essential nutrients that play complementary roles in maintaining overall health, particularly in bone and cardiovascular systems. While vitamin D3 enhances calcium absorption, vitamin K2 ensures that calcium is properly utilized by directing it to bones and teeth rather than soft tissues or arteries. This synergy has led to growing interest in whether taking vitamin D3 alongside K2 maximizes their benefits and minimizes potential risks, such as calcium buildup in arteries. Research suggests that combining these vitamins may improve bone density, reduce arterial calcification, and support heart health, making their joint supplementation a topic of significant importance for those looking to optimize their nutrient intake.

Synergistic Effects: D3 aids calcium absorption; K2 directs it to bones, preventing arterial calcification
Vitamin D3 and K2 are often discussed together due to their complementary roles in calcium metabolism. While D3 enhances calcium absorption in the gut, K2 ensures that this calcium is properly utilized by the body, directing it to the bones and teeth where it’s needed most. Without K2, calcium absorbed with the help of D3 might end up in soft tissues, arteries, or kidneys, leading to calcification and potential health risks. This partnership highlights why taking these vitamins together can be more effective than supplementing with D3 alone.
Consider the mechanism: D3 increases calcium levels in the bloodstream by promoting its absorption from food. However, elevated calcium without proper direction can be harmful. Here’s where K2 steps in—specifically, the MK-7 form, which activates proteins like osteocalcin. These proteins bind calcium and deposit it into bone tissue, strengthening skeletal structure. For adults over 50, this synergy is particularly crucial, as bone density naturally declines with age, increasing the risk of osteoporosis. A typical dosage might include 1,000–2,000 IU of D3 paired with 100–200 mcg of K2 daily, though individual needs vary based on factors like sun exposure and diet.
The risk of arterial calcification underscores the importance of this pairing. Studies suggest that while D3 alone can improve calcium absorption, it may inadvertently contribute to plaque buildup in arteries if K2 is insufficient. This is especially concerning for individuals with cardiovascular risk factors, such as hypertension or high cholesterol. By ensuring calcium is directed to bones rather than arteries, K2 acts as a safeguard, making the combination of D3 and K2 a smarter choice for long-term health. For those with pre-existing heart conditions, consulting a healthcare provider before starting supplementation is essential.
Practical implementation matters. Pairing D3 and K2 supplements is straightforward, but timing and form can enhance effectiveness. Both are fat-soluble vitamins, so taking them with a meal containing healthy fats (like avocado, nuts, or olive oil) improves absorption. Morning or midday dosing is ideal, as it aligns with the body’s natural circadian rhythm and avoids potential interference with sleep. For those who prefer food sources, combining D3-rich foods (fatty fish, egg yolks) with K2 sources (fermented foods like natto, grass-fed dairy) can provide a natural synergy, though supplements may be necessary to meet optimal levels, especially in regions with limited sunlight.
In summary, the combination of D3 and K2 isn’t just a trend—it’s a science-backed approach to maximizing calcium’s benefits while minimizing risks. By working together, these vitamins support bone health, prevent arterial calcification, and promote overall well-being. Whether through supplements or diet, ensuring adequate intake of both is a proactive step toward maintaining strong bones and a healthy cardiovascular system. Always tailor dosages to individual needs and consult a healthcare professional for personalized advice.

Dosage Recommendations: Optimal ratios of D3 to K2 for maximum health benefits
Vitamin D3 and K2 are a dynamic duo in the world of supplements, each playing a unique role in maintaining overall health. While Vitamin D3 is renowned for its ability to enhance calcium absorption and support bone health, Vitamin K2 ensures that this calcium is properly utilized, directing it to the bones and teeth rather than allowing it to accumulate in soft tissues or arteries. The synergy between these two vitamins is undeniable, but the question remains: what is the optimal ratio for maximum health benefits?
Establishing the Right Balance
Determining the ideal D3 to K2 ratio requires an understanding of their individual functions and how they interact. A common recommendation is to take 100 mcg of Vitamin K2 (as MK-7, the most bioavailable form) for every 5,000 IU of Vitamin D3. This ratio is based on studies suggesting that K2 helps mitigate the potential risks of excessive calcium buildup associated with high-dose D3 supplementation. For instance, a daily intake of 2,000–5,000 IU of D3 paired with 100–200 mcg of K2 is often advised for adults seeking to optimize bone and cardiovascular health.
Tailoring Dosage to Individual Needs
Age, health status, and lifestyle factors significantly influence the optimal D3 to K2 ratio. For older adults, particularly those with osteoporosis or cardiovascular concerns, a higher ratio of K2 to D3 may be beneficial. For example, a 70-year-old individual might consider 10,000 IU of D3 with 300 mcg of K2 daily, under medical supervision. Conversely, younger, healthy adults may require a lower K2 dose, such as 50–100 mcg, when paired with 2,000–4,000 IU of D3. Pregnant or breastfeeding women should consult a healthcare provider, as their needs may differ.
Practical Tips for Optimal Absorption
To maximize the benefits of this combination, timing and form matter. Both D3 and K2 are fat-soluble vitamins, so taking them with a meal containing healthy fats (e.g., avocado, nuts, or olive oil) enhances absorption. Additionally, consider liquid or softgel formulations, which tend to have higher bioavailability than tablets. Monitor your levels through regular blood tests, as excessive D3 without adequate K2 can lead to imbalances. Adjust the ratio as needed based on your health goals and lab results.
Cautions and Considerations
While the D3-K2 combination is generally safe, certain individuals should exercise caution. Those on blood-thinning medications like warfarin must consult a doctor, as K2 can interfere with anticoagulant effects. Similarly, individuals with kidney issues or hypercalcemia should avoid high-dose D3 without medical advice. Always start with lower doses and gradually increase while monitoring for any adverse effects. Remember, supplementation should complement, not replace, a balanced diet and healthy lifestyle.

Health Benefits: Improved bone density, heart health, and immune function when combined
Vitamin D3 and K2 are often hailed as a dynamic duo in the supplement world, but their combined benefits go beyond mere hype. When taken together, these vitamins work synergistically to enhance bone density, support heart health, and bolster immune function. This isn’t just theoretical—studies show that Vitamin D3 improves calcium absorption, while Vitamin K2 directs that calcium to bones and teeth, preventing it from accumulating in arteries or soft tissues. For adults over 30, this combination becomes particularly crucial as bone density naturally declines and cardiovascular risks increase. A daily dose of 1,000–2,000 IU of Vitamin D3 paired with 90–120 mcg of Vitamin K2 (MK-7 form) is commonly recommended, though individual needs may vary.
Consider the heart health implications: Vitamin D3 reduces inflammation and supports arterial flexibility, but without K2, calcium can build up in blood vessels, leading to arterial stiffness. This is where K2 steps in, activating proteins that keep calcium out of arteries and in bones. A 2017 study in the *Journal of the American Heart Association* found that higher Vitamin K2 intake was associated with a reduced risk of coronary heart disease. For those with a family history of cardiovascular issues or individuals over 50, this combination could be a preventive measure. Pairing these supplements with a diet rich in leafy greens (natural K1 sources) and moderate sun exposure (for natural D3 synthesis) amplifies their effects.
Immune function also benefits from this pairing. Vitamin D3 is known to modulate immune responses, reducing the risk of infections and autoimmune disorders. K2, while less studied in this area, supports overall health by ensuring proper calcium metabolism, which indirectly aids immune cell function. During colder months or for those with limited sun exposure, supplementing with D3 and K2 can be particularly beneficial. For instance, a 2020 study in *Frontiers in Immunology* highlighted that adequate Vitamin D levels were linked to lower susceptibility to respiratory infections. Adding K2 ensures that the body utilizes the absorbed calcium efficiently, preventing imbalances that could otherwise weaken immune responses.
Practical implementation is key. For optimal absorption, take these supplements with a meal containing healthy fats, as both vitamins are fat-soluble. Avoid taking them with calcium supplements unless advised by a healthcare provider, as K2’s role in calcium distribution could be disrupted. Pregnant women, individuals on blood thinners, or those with kidney conditions should consult a doctor before starting this regimen. While the benefits are clear, over-supplementation can lead to toxicity, so sticking to recommended dosages is essential. Combining D3 and K2 isn’t just about taking two pills—it’s about creating a balanced approach to health that addresses multiple systems simultaneously.

Potential Risks: Over-supplementation risks without K2, such as calcium buildup in arteries
Vitamin D3 supplementation, while beneficial for bone health and immune function, can lead to unintended consequences when taken in excess without the balancing presence of vitamin K2. One of the most concerning risks is calcium buildup in arteries, a condition known as arterial calcification. This occurs because vitamin D3 increases calcium absorption in the gut, but without K2, that calcium may not be properly directed to bones and teeth, instead accumulating in soft tissues like blood vessels. Studies suggest that individuals taking high doses of vitamin D3 (above 4,000 IU daily) without K2 are at a higher risk of this issue, particularly in older adults or those with pre-existing cardiovascular conditions.
To mitigate this risk, experts recommend pairing vitamin D3 with vitamin K2, specifically in the MK-7 form, which has a longer half-life and is more effective at activating proteins that regulate calcium distribution. A typical dosage is 100–200 mcg of K2 for every 5,000 IU of D3. For example, if you’re taking 2,000 IU of D3 daily, 50–100 mcg of K2 would suffice. This combination ensures that calcium is deposited in bones rather than arteries, reducing the risk of cardiovascular complications. Always consult a healthcare provider before adjusting dosages, especially if you’re on blood thinners, as K2 can interfere with their efficacy.
The absence of K2 in a high-D3 regimen can exacerbate risks for certain populations. Postmenopausal women, for instance, are already at increased risk of arterial calcification due to hormonal changes, and over-supplementing with D3 alone could worsen this. Similarly, individuals with chronic kidney disease or those on calcium-rich diets may face heightened risks. Practical tips include monitoring calcium intake from food and supplements, opting for a D3+K2 combined supplement, and regularly testing vitamin D levels to avoid excessive dosing.
In contrast to the risks, when D3 and K2 are taken together, they work synergistically to promote cardiovascular and bone health. K2 activates matrix GLA protein (MGP), a potent inhibitor of arterial calcification, while D3 ensures adequate calcium levels for bone mineralization. This partnership highlights the importance of a balanced approach to supplementation. Ignoring this synergy could turn a well-intentioned health strategy into a potential hazard, underscoring the need for informed, tailored supplementation.

Food Sources: Natural combinations of D3 and K2 in foods like fatty fish and cheese
Fatty fish like salmon, mackerel, and herring are nutritional powerhouses, offering a rare natural combination of vitamin D3 and vitamin K2. A 3-ounce serving of wild-caught salmon provides approximately 600–1,000 IU of vitamin D3, while also containing trace amounts of K2 in the form of menaquinone-4 (MK-4). This pairing is no accident—both vitamins are fat-soluble and synergistic, with D3 promoting calcium absorption and K2 directing it to bones rather than arteries. For those aiming to optimize bone and heart health, incorporating these fish 2–3 times per week can be a strategic dietary choice, particularly for adults over 50 who are at higher risk of osteoporosis and cardiovascular issues.
Cheese, often overlooked as a health food, is another surprising source of both D3 and K2, especially in fermented varieties like Gouda and blue cheese. While the D3 content is modest (around 10–20 IU per ounce), the K2 levels are more significant, with Gouda providing up to 76 mcg of MK-4 per 100 grams. This makes cheese a convenient option for those who don’t consume fatty fish regularly. Pairing a small portion of cheese with a D3-rich food like egg yolks (which contain 37 IU of D3 per yolk) can create a balanced intake. However, moderation is key—cheese is high in saturated fat, so limit portions to 1–2 ounces daily, especially for individuals monitoring cholesterol levels.
For those following plant-based diets, achieving adequate D3 and K2 through food alone can be challenging, as natural sources are predominantly animal-based. Natto, a fermented soybean dish, is a notable exception, offering an impressive 850 mcg of K2 (MK-7) per 100 grams, though its D3 content is negligible. Combining natto with fortified foods like D3-enriched mushrooms (which provide up to 400 IU per 100 grams) can bridge the gap. Alternatively, pairing plant-based K2 sources with a D3 supplement (1000–2000 IU daily) ensures sufficient intake without relying on animal products.
Practical tips for maximizing D3 and K2 synergy through diet include preparing meals that combine these nutrients, such as a salmon and spinach salad topped with Gouda cheese, or a breakfast of scrambled eggs with natto. For children and adolescents, whose bone development relies heavily on these vitamins, incorporating fatty fish and fermented dairy into family meals can be particularly beneficial. Always consider individual health conditions—those on blood thinners should consult a healthcare provider before increasing K2 intake, as it can affect anticoagulant medications. By prioritizing these natural combinations, individuals can support bone density, cardiovascular health, and overall well-being through thoughtful dietary choices.
